A "dual audio" file means the video contains two different language tracks. Usually, this includes the original English audio and a dubbed language, like Hindi or Spanish.
Most 1080p releases pair the high-res video with AC3 or DTS 5.1 surround sound , whereas 720p versions often use AAC 2.0 stereo . Higher bitrates and pixel density preserve the subtle gradations in shadows. You will see less "color banding" (blocky artifacts in dark areas) and more texture in Logan's clothing and the surrounding environments.
